WebBlood Thalassemia and the hemoglobinopathies. Hemoglobin is composed of a porphyrin compound (heme) and globin. Normal adult hemoglobin (Hb A) consists of globin containing two pairs of chains of amino acids, of which the alpha chain consists of 141 amino acids, the beta chain 146. HbD Punjab also known as HbD Los Angeles is a β-chain variant and is characterized by a Glu →Gln substitution at codon 121 with a G AA →C AA change at the DNA level and the electrophotetic mobility at alkaline pH is similar to HbS (β6, Glu →Val).[1]

WebSep 14, 2024 · HbS beta-thalassemia: A person inherits a sickle cell gene from one parent and a gene for beta ... and 1 in 13 are born with the trait. Sickle cell disease affects about 1 in 16,300 Hispanic ...

WebHb S-beta thalassemia disease - People with this condition inherit a beta thalassemia variant from one parent and Hb S from the other parent. This is a form of sickle cell disease.
